Output debad41e4d110c5fb4fae4de11843afcbf28cc7cc196fc3497a03c30da10ebee:1

value
1405000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6425796e505d99189bdf575bafc8a3fb68cce0d2 OP_EQUAL
address
3ApYPVM75Ss5BEKhTCeyELTZEHnquEGr21
transaction
debad41e4d110c5fb4fae4de11843afcbf28cc7cc196fc3497a03c30da10ebee
confirmations
473099
spent
true